
Jérôme Sourisseau
Jérôme Sourisseau is a centrist politician who previously served as the president of the Charente departmental council from 2020 to 2021. As a member of the opposition, he has been vocal in demanding the resignation of current president Philippe Bouty following a political crisis that has seen the council unable to pass a budget, leading to the intervention of the regional financial control body.
